Don’t be afraid of thinking big, if you want to fund cheap green energy


Steven Day and his two co-founders realised that they were pitching to the wrong peopleEntrepreneurs often describe the process of raising venture funding for their businesses as gruelling and Steven Day, co-founder of the green energy provider Pure Planet, is no exception. The pitch was simple: they were building a renewable energy company that offered customers green power at a lower price than fossil fuels. It could do that and still make money by buying well in the wholesale markets, keeping overheads low and being as digital as possible from the get-go.
